Collagenna Skin Care Products specializes in Anti-aging products with an emphasis on Collagen stimulation both topically and internally. The company sells its products mainly through specialized skin care clinics through its every expanding network of distribution partners.

It is estimated that the European cosmeceuticals market will be worth more than $4 billion in 2009. In Europe, France and Germany follow behind the U.S. in their demand for drug-based beauty products, with sales turnover of nourishers/anti-aging products in 2007 at $1.2 billion and $1.1 billion, respectively (Kline Group, 2010).

In the U.S., the cosmeceutical market was worth $16 billion and forecasts for 2012 put the market at $21 billion (Packaged Facts, 2010).

OTTAWA, ONTARIO--(Marketwire - 03/22/11) - Axia Group (PINK SHEETS:AGIJ - News) () subsidiary Collagenna Skin Care Products/Melem Secret is pleased to announce that it has received several promising inquiries from companies in China that are interested in distributing its anti-aging products.

China is one of the fastest growing and still untapped cosmetics markets in the world. The skin care segment is leading the way, as a wide cross-section of the country's huge population is driving diversified demand for new products. Anti-aging skin care creams, moisturizers, whitening formulations and toners have all shown impressive growth. The Chinese cosmetics industry is estimated to be valued at between $5 billion and $10 billion annually, and skin care covers more than 80 per cent of the country's cosmetics market. The skin care segment is expected to have a compound annual growth rate of 12.7 per cent in the forecast period covering 2010 to 2013.

The primary distribution channels for cosmetics in China include supermarkets, malls, online shops and direct selling. Direct selling is a growth sector, particularly in smaller cities where cheaper products and convenience makes it more effective.
